Subject: Quickstore 4.2 — bloom filter now fronts the KV layer

Plugin authors: starting with this release, Quickstore places a bloom filter ahead of the key-value store. Negative lookups return faster; false positives fall through safely. No API changes are required on your side. Verify your plugin against the staging build referenced below.

session token of fahif-tadup = htk3_9c7

Ticket: QueueCrest autoscaler credentials expired

The API key QueueCrest uses to poll the internal queue-metrics service expired at 02:00, so autoscaling decisions have been frozen on last-known depth since then. Worker pools held steady, no customer impact observed. A replacement key with identical read-only scope has been issued and needs to go into the release pipeline's secret store before Thursday's deploy. For the release manager: the new key for the queue-metrics service is below.

API key for tagef-fafop: vxb2-ta

Confirm the Tarnow-built decoder handles GS1 DataBar and damaged Code 128 labels against the full regression deck, not just the smoke subset. Check that fallback manual-entry mode logs correctly to the Opsfield audit stream and that scanner firmware pinning matches the manifest Delia approved on Tuesday. Do not promote if any of the 42 label fixtures fail twice consecutively. Once all boxes are green, record the promoted artifact by pasting the identifier directly beneath this item.

session token of hawif-bajog = htk6_9ab8da